From 33434d5f045072c876b511dbe42af66adb56eae1 Mon Sep 17 00:00:00 2001 From: Yonghong Song Date: Fri, 3 May 2019 16:40:16 +0000 Subject: [PATCH] [Docs][CodeGenerator][eBPF] Correct the values for BPF_X and BPF_K Fix the values of BPF_X and BPF_K according to BPFInstrFormats.td: " def BPF_K : BPFSrcType<0x0>; def BPF_X : BPFSrcType<0x1>; " The right value for BPF_X is 0x1, and the right value for BPF_K is 0x0. Signed-off-by: Wang YanQing Differential Revision: https://reviews.llvm.org/D61512 llvm-svn: 359904 --- llvm/docs/CodeGenerator.rst |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/llvm/docs/CodeGenerator.rst b/llvm/docs/CodeGenerator.rst index 22c0714..e7f96e8 100644 --- a/llvm/docs/CodeGenerator.rst +++ b/llvm/docs/CodeGenerator.rst @@ -2527,8 +2527,8 @@ When BPF_CLASS(code) == BPF_ALU or BPF_ALU64 or BPF_JMP, :: - BPF_X 0x0 use src_reg register as source operand - BPF_K 0x1 use 32 bit immediate as source operand + BPF_X 0x1 use src_reg register as source operand + BPF_K 0x0 use 32 bit immediate as source operand and four MSB bits store operation code -- 2.7.4